The Green Science program offers students without German language skills the opportunity to obtain a Bachelor of Science in Engineering (BSc) at the University of Applied Sciences Upper Austria. The Green Science program builds on a solid natural science foundation with indepth knowledge of many aspects of engineering and technology.

The opportunity for non-German speaking students to obtain a Bachelor of Science (BSc) in Engineering at the University of Applied Sciences Upper Austria begins in the first year with preparation courses that build a solid natural science foundation. No German language knowledge? No problem!
A thorough two-year German course package will prepare you for your entry into the German-taught majors.
